Erick Hunter to Shine at 2026 HBCU Showcase Pro Day in Virginia
Erick Hunter, also known as "E40," is making a significant career move as he prepares for the 2026 HBCU Showcase and International Player Pathway Pro Day. This event, scheduled for March 28–30 in Ashburn, Virginia, is a crucial platform for draft-eligible players to demonstrate their skills to NFL scouts and team executives. Hunter, representing the Mid-Eastern Athletic Conference (MEAC), excelled in his senior season with notable statistics and honors, positioning him for a potential NFL career.
By the Numbers- Led MEAC with 102 total tackles in senior season.
- Recorded 14 tackles for loss and 4 sacks during the year.
- Finished second on Morgan State's all-time tackles list with 298 career stops.
- All 32 NFL teams will attend the event, enhancing visibility for participating prospects.
- Hunter is one of 11 MEAC representatives at the invite-only Showcase.
- Showcase includes both HBCU prospects and athletes from the International Player Pathway.
